General information EPYC 7643 Xeon E5-2667 v2
Launched Q1 2021 Q1 2014
Used in Server Server
Factory AMD Intel
Socket SP3 LGA2011
Clock 2.3 GHz 30.3 % 3.3 GHz 0 %
Turbo Clock 3.6 GHz 10 % 4 GHz 0 %
Cores 48 0 % 8 83.3 %
Threads 96 0 % 16 83.3 %
Thermal Design Power (TDP) 225 W 0 % 130 W 42.2 %
